The Creative Labs Outlier Air V3 earbuds offer great value, especially for exercise, with sweatproof certification and a secure fit for active use. The smaller design makes them convenient for travel, but their sound quality may not be as immersive compared to the Soundcore Life Q20. The Soundcore headphones, while more expensive, offer better sound isolation and are more comfortable for long periods, making them well-suited for air travel and focused listening. If call quality and battery life are important, both choices are adequate, but the Soundcore Life Q20 has active noise cancellation, which is absent in the Outlier Air V3, giving the Soundcore an edge in noisy environments. About Creative Labs

Creative Labs is a Singaporean technology company specialized in the manufacture of multimedia products. They created the world-famous Soundblaster soundcard back in 1989 which was a staple of the gaming community for a long time. Nowadays, besides still marketing their discrete audio systems, they offer a wide array of headphones, gaming headsets and speakers that still preserve that same heritage.

About Soundcore

Soundcore is a sub-brand belonging to Anker Innovations. Starting in 2014, initially marketing wireless, Bluetooth, speakers, Anker now offers an array of, budget-friendly, wireless earbuds and headphones that directly compete, especially in the Active Noise Canceling field, with other brands several times as expensive.
